The Mogensen Trail offers a captivating journey along the Snake River, where you'll be treated to dramatic canyon views and unique basalt formations. The well-worn dirt path winds past sagebrush slopes and small waterfalls created by springs trickling down the cliffs. You'll even cross a small footbridge, making for a varied and engaging experience.
This easy 2.2-mile (3.5 km) out-and-back hike involves about 337 feet (103 metres) of elevation gain and takes roughly 1 hour and 2 minutes. The trailhead is easy to find, and while it's generally an accessible route, some rocky sections and stairs mean it's not suitable for strollers. Tennis shoes are recommended for comfort on the dusty or potentially muddy path.
What truly sets this trail apart is its proximity to the I.B. Perrine Bridge, a renowned spot for BASE jumping. You might witness jumpers leaping from the bridge and landing in a field near the trail's end, an unforgettable spectacle. The trail actually cuts through a BASE jumpers' landing pad, so be aware and give them space if they are present.
